— Did you ever kill anybody?
— I'm sorry. Well, it's just not a simple question. I just can't answer it like... When I was a kid in East Harlem... the wops said... no spics could go east of Park Avenue. Spooks said: west of Fifth Avenue." That don't leave you much room to maneuver. Say you want to go to Central Park, play with the ducks. You're shit outta luck. So what do you do? You go anyway. I'm up on 106th Street, Central Park, near the lake. I get caught by these Copiens. Right? They surround me. So I get my blood up, pull out my blade. I said: I'll take any one of you mothers!" They say: your ass." Out come the zip guns. Homemade gun. You pull the hook back, catch that bullet square, ping. Hit you in the head, man, you got serious problems. That was the last chase on me like that... because from then on I carried my own piece. Guys went down, yeah, but it ain't like, you know, you just... decide one day, and then that's it. No. You just do what you gotta do to survive. Somehow, you know, you just end up where you are.
